Magic Kingdom's 'Ferrytale Fireworks Dessert Cruise' returns from refurbishment at a higher price

Jun 27, 2023 in "Ferrytale Fireworks - A Fireworks Dessert Cruise"

Posted: Tuesday June 27, 2023 2:00pm ET by WDWMAGIC Staff

Walt Disney World's "Ferrytale Fireworks: A Sparkling Dessert Cruise" is now available for booking with sailings starting July 12 2023.

The new pricing is $130 for adults and $100 for ages 3 - 9. The 1.5-hour experience was previously priced at $99 and $69. The fireworks cruise closed in March 2023 for a refurbishment.

Along with a viewing of the Magic Kingdom's firework show, guests on the cruise can enjoy cheeses, desserts and a selection of specialty drinks with alcohol included.
